WebMemantine hydrochloride extended-release capsules should not be divided, chewed, or crushed. If a patient misses a single dose of memantine hydrochloride extended … WebNAMENDA XR capsules should not be divided, chewed, or crushed. WebDec 13, 2024 · Medications that can’t be split in half are usually designed to release in the body in a certain way. These are called modified-release dosage forms.
